Desktop Icons Missing or Disappeared on Mac: How to Fix

In this guide, we will show you various methods to fix the issue wherein the desktop icons are missing or have disappeared from your Mac. Numerous users have voiced their concern that the icons from their desktops have vanished into the thin air all of a sudden.

For some, it started after an OS upgrade whereas others have said that it happened simply after a normal reboot. If you are also in the same boat, then fret not as you could easily bring those icons back to your desktop. And in this guide, we will show you how to do just that. Follow along.

FIX 2: Restart Finder

You might also get bugged with this issue if the Finder is not working along the expected lines due to its background services not functioning properly. In such cases, your best bet is to restart Finder and then check out the results. Here’s how it could be done:

  1. Click on the Apple logo situated at the top left and select Force Quit.
  2. Then select Finder from the list and hit Relaunch. Wait for it to restart.
  3. Now check if it fixes the desktop icons missing or disappeared on your Mac.

FIX 3: Tweak Finder Settings

Next up, you should also verify that the Finder has been instructed to show those files and folders on your Mac in the first place. Here’s how:

  1. Launch Finder, click on Finder at the top menu bar, and select Preferences.
  2. Now checkmark the desired items under Show these items on Desktop.
  3. Check if it fixes the desktop icons missing or disappeared on your Mac.

FIX 4: Tweak iCloud Desktop Settings

If you are using iCloud to back up your files on the desktop, then it might also lead to this issue. So you should consider tweaking its setting using the below-given instructions and then check out the results.

  1. Click on the Apple logo, select System Preferences, and click on Apple ID.
  2. Then select iCloud from the left-hand side and click Options next to iCloud Drive.
  3. After that, checkmark Desktop and Document Folders and hit Done.
  4. Check if it fixes the desktop icons missing or disappeared on your Mac.

FIX 5: Unhide Items via Terminal

You could also unhide the file and folders from your desktop using a single line of command. Here’s how:

  1. Open Launchpad, go to the Others folder, and launch Terminal.
  2. Then execute the below command in the Terminal Window: defaults write com.apple.finder CreateDesktop true; killall Finder
  3. Check if it fixes the desktop icons missing or disappeared on your Mac.

FIX 6: Delete Corrupt Preferences Files

In some cases, this issue might also arise if the Finder and Desktop Files get corrupted. Therefore, you should delete both these files and then let the OS create a fresh instance of the same from scratch. Here’s how it could be done:

  1. Open Finder, click on Go at the top menu bar, and select Library
  2. Then go to the Preferences folder and delete the following files [or move it to any other directory, it will act as a backup] com.apple.finder.plist com.apple.desktop.plist
  3. In some cases, you will only find one of these two files, so whichever is present, delete/move it.
  4. Once done, restart your Mac. The OS will now recreate these plist files. Once done, the issue should have been fixed.
